Polarization dependent photoionization cross-sections and radiative lifetimes of atomic states in Ba

Li, C. -H. · Budker, D.

Original · EN

The photoionization cross-sections of two even-parity excited states, 5d6d ³D₁ and 6s7d ³D₂, of atomic Ba at the ionization-laser wavelength of 556.6 nm were measured. We found that the total cross-section depends on the relative polarization of the atoms and the ionization-laser light. With density-matrix algebra, we show that, in general, there are at most three parameters in the photoionization cross-section. Some of these parameters are determined in this work. We also present the measurement of the radiative lifetime of five even-parity excited states of barium.
